Biography


Derwin A. Valdez, 47, of Penasco, NM, and more recently from Los Lunas, NM was called home by Our Dear Father in Albuquerque on August 26, 2010, after a long illness. He was born at Fort Meade, Maryland and as a military dependent lived in various parts of the US. Attended schools in Denver, San Antonio and Colorado Springs and graduated from Penasco High School. He graduated from a Denver Electronic School specializing in automotive circuitry. Derwin was an altar server for 7 years. He had a huge heart full of love and compassion; was prideful in helping people with auto repairs often without charge. He is preceded in death one year to the day by his mother, Elvia L. Valdez of Penasco, NM; an infant sister, and his beloved uncle Gilbert Valdez, of Vadito, NM. Derwin is survived by three sons, Maurice Valdez (Sandra), Los Lunas, NM; David and Elijah Gonzales, Dixon, NM; two grandchildren; also surviving is his father, retired Chief Master Sargent Octaviano A. Valdez, Penasco, NM and his nine siblings: Yvonne Arellano (Nelson), Colorado Springs, CO; Edwin Valdez (Eunice), Ranchos de Taos, NM; Rita Valdez, Rio Lucio, NM; Gloria Valdez, Highlands Ranch, CO; Joey Valdez, Penasco, NM; Rudy Valdez (Elizabeth), Chamisal, NM; Valerie Valdez (Manuel Sandoval), Taos, NM; Derrick Valdez (Vickey), Ft. Knox, KY; and Melissa Lopez (Joseph), Albuquerque, NM. He is further survived by 27 nieces and nephews; numerous aunts and uncles and many friends in the Penasco area.

Rosary was recited August 29th at San Antonio de Padua Catholic Church, Penasco. Burial mass Monday, August 30th at San Antonio de Padua Catholic Church, followed by ash interment at the Vadito Catholic Cemetery.
